Do the basic checks of checking over Earth's on the car, there's lots of them.

 

Check each fuse (take image so you don't accidentally place in wrong slot afterwards)

 

Get a fault code scanner on the car like VCDS (forum has member list available) and see what is stored there.

 

A fair few potential issues, but try to clear out the basics first.
